The beta extension of the green app introduces “Chat Lock” which features hiding threads of conversation from other lists of chats on the green app.
WhatsApp rolled out an enhancement to its Android Beta app (v2.23.24.20) that extends Chat Lock with a new Secret Code toggle—allowing locked conversations not only to require device authentication, but to be entirely hidden from the Chats list.
Chat Lock will feature on WhatsApp Messenger – this feature is added to the various layers of the security system the green app parent company has embedded. Chat Lock security system does not delete nor added to an archive chat folder, yet it is developed to create a standalone folder to house hidden chats.
Meta – WhatsApp parent company confirmed the new privacy options tweaked in the green app Settings. “New locked chats in WhatsApp make your conversations more private. They’re hidden in a password-protected folder and notifications won’t show sender or message content,” Meta CEO, Mark Zuckerberg said.
According to the WhatsApp report, the new feature under development in the beta landscape has the typical security standards that require users’ password or biometric profiles such as fingerprints or facial recognition profiles saved on the device.
